Storage Devices

Storage devices allow the Notebook PC to read or write documents, pictures, and other files to various data storage devices. This Notebook PC has the following storage devices:

Expansion Card

Optical drive

Flash memory reader

Hard disk drive

Inserting an Expansion Card

Be sure the card is level when inserting.

1. If there is a plastic protector in the slot, remove it using the removing instructions below.

2.Insert the card with the connector side first and label side up. Standard cards will be flush with the Notebook PC when fully inserted.

3.Carefully connect any cables or adapters needed by the card. Usually connectors can only be inserted in one orientation. Look for a sticker, icon, or marking on one side of the connector representing the top side.

Removing an Expansion Card

To remove the card, first remove all cables or adapters attached to the card, then double-click the Safely Remove Hardware icon on the Windows taskbar and stop the card before removing.
